In other news the polls for MoF 26: Guns, Germs and Steel and for MoF 21: VOX POPULI - Map duel for Honour and Glory have finished and the winners of both have been decided!

We've been waiting a long time to find out the winner of MoF 21: VOX POPULI and now, after months of waiting, the decision has finally been made. The honoured winner of MoF 21 is...

LSCatilina!

Ares96 and LSCatilina had their work cut out for them in this Map Duel as both are good map-makers. Ares96 didn't roll over, and instead delivered a great map depicting the break-up of Mexico into small "Filibuster" republics, but LSCatilina's map of a weakened and broken apart United States won in the end. Both of them deserve congratulations for your excellent contributions to this hard-fought round of Map of the Fortnight!


As mentioned previously, the voting for MoF 26: Guns, Germs and Steel has finished too, and the honoured winner is...

B_Munro!

B_Munro's talent as a map-maker lies in his ability to conjure scenarios and worlds that capture the imagination of all AH.commers. His winning entry for this round involved a technologically advanced India; a backwards, barbarous Europe; and an autocratic, Persian meritocracy. What's not to love?
